Understanding Knowledge Graphs
Knowledge Graphs (KGs) represent information using structured frameworks, employing Subject-Predicate-Object (SPO) triples to map relationships. This explicit configuration allows for deterministic queries, making KGs invaluable for applications requiring clear, unambiguous data retrieval. The Role of Vector Databases
Conversely, Vector Databases focus on capturing semantic relationships through unstructured data, making them ideal for applications that rely on implicit connections. Deciding Between Knowledge Graphs and Vector Databases
The decision to use KGs or Vector Databases hinges on specific business requirements. Organizations must evaluate the nature of their data and how it will be used. For example, if a company is focused on analyzing explicit data points for better decision-making, KGs may be the way to go. However, if the priority lies in understanding and predicting user behavior through non-linear data, Vector Databases would be more effective.
